Quality Assurance Manager
**Company Overview:** Our client is a well-established specialty ingredient manufacturer serving the food and beverage industry. With a focus on innovation and quality excellence, they produce high-value color solutions and sweet ingredient systems for leading brands nationwide.
**Location:** Onsite in Anaheim, CA
**Compensation:** $80,000-$100,000k/year
**Type:** Direct-hire
**Hours:** M-F 8-5
Essential Duties:
+ Direct and oversee all quality assurance functions to maintain product safety, quality standards, and regulatory adherence throughout daily operations.
+ Manage the resolution of quality deviations, investigate customer feedback issues, and implement corrective and preventive measures.
+ Oversee quality control activities including inspection protocols, sample analysis, testing procedures, and approval processes for incoming materials, in-process production, and final products.
+ Maintain and enhance food safety management systems encompassing allergen management, sanitation verification, product traceability, and vendor approval programs.
+ Execute internal compliance assessments and provide support during regulatory inspections and third-party certification audits.
+ Develop and deliver training programs for quality personnel and manufacturing teams on quality systems and food safety requirements.
+ Manage quality records and documentation systems including production records, certificates of analysis, and deviation documentation.
+ Contribute to technical specification creation and updates for both new product launches and existing product portfolios, with emphasis on specialty color and confectionery ingredient applications.
Required Qualifications:
+ Bachelor's degree in Food Science, Industrial Microbiology, Chemistry, or closely related scientific discipline strongly preferred.
+ Minimum 3 years of progressive quality assurance experience within food processing or ingredient manufacturing operations.
+ Comprehensive understanding of FDA regulatory framework, HACCP methodology, GMP requirements, and Global Food Safety Initiative standards (such as SQF or BRC certification schemes).
+ Demonstrated capability in root cause investigation techniques and corrective/preventive action system management.
+ Strong supervisory capabilities with excellent verbal and written communication skills and organizational abilities.
+ Proven ability to excel in a high-paced, collaborative production environment while maintaining meticulous attention to detail.
+ HACCP certification or PCQI (Preventive Controls Qualified Individual) credential.
+ SQF Practitioner or BRC auditor training.
